Benefits of vitamin c in cosmetics
Vitamin C, also called ascorbic acid, is a substance with powerful antioxidant capable of protecting the skin from damage by free radicals cause.
In cosmetics, Vitamin C or vitamin A commonly used in many derivatives different to fit each type of skin and specific needs.
The common form of Vitamin C in cosmetics include:
- L-ascorbic acid: Format original, most effective, but easily oxidized.
- Sodium Ascorbyl Phosphate: More stable, in accordance with sensitive skin.
- Magnesium Ascorbyl Phosphate: Provide effective nursing bright and soothe the skin.
Each derivative has its own characteristics, but the general points are oriented to improving the health of skin, bringing fresh, young skin radiant.
The main use of Vitamin C for beautiful skin
Increase collagen production
Collagen is the “skeleton” of the skin, helps to maintain firmness and elasticity. When we get older the amount of collagen in the body decreases gradually, causing skin to sag and wrinkles appear.
Vitamin C is a key component involved in the synthesis of collagen, which helps skin stay smooth and full of life.
Research shows the Vitamin C supplements in the right way can significantly reduce the signs of aging such as wrinkles, while enhancing elasticity to the skin.
Skin lightening, skin
If you are looking for a solution to improve skin tone and blur the bruising, pigmentation, Vitamin C is the perfect choice.
Vitamin C acts by inhibiting the production of melanin (the pigment that causes darkening of the skin). As a result the skin becomes bright, smooth, both color and more radiant.
In addition, the use of Vitamin C regularly also helps reduce the risk of increased skin pigmentation due to harmful effects of the sun.
Protects against environmental damage
Every day, our skin is exposed to many harmful environmental factors such as UV rays, dust, and pollution. Free radicals from these factors can destroy the structure of skin cells, leading to premature aging and loss of radiance.
Vitamin C, with its powerful antioxidant properties, helps protect the skin from the effects of free radicals. Not only that, it also helps restore damaged skin, helping you maintain healthy and youthful skin.
The product shape contains Vitamin C popular
Vitamin C Serum
Vitamin C Serum is one of the most popular products on the beauty market. With texture, lighter fluid, permeability, fast and effective high serum is usually recommended immediately after the step of cleaning the skin.
This is a product that helps the skin absorb the maximum nutrients, promote the regeneration process and protects against the harmful agents from the environment such as UV rays and pollution.
In addition, serum Vitamin C also supports fade wrinkles, improve elasticity and skin, becoming indispensable option in the process of daily skin care.
Cream Vitamin C
- Cream Vitamin C is the perfect combination between moisturize and brighten skin. This product not only replenish water and moisturize the skin but also helps to reduce dark pigmentation and enhance skin's resistance.
- Especially suitable for those who want a minimalist skin care procedures but still desire to achieve high efficiency. With denser texture serum, nourishing cream often used in the final step of the process, lotion to lock in moisture and protect the layer nutrients have apply earlier.
Powder Vitamin C
- Powder Vitamin C is the product shape is quite versatile and refreshing in the beauty market. This is the ideal choice for those who want to adjust the dosage and usage.
- Powder Vitamin C may be mixed directly with the skin care products such as serum or cream to enhance the effect.
- However, the use of powder Vitamin C requires that the user should pay attention to the dosage and check the compatibility of products before applying to the skin to avoid irritation.
Note when using cosmetics containing Vitamin C
How to choose product
- Choose products with the concentration of Vitamin C appropriate, the ideal is between 10% to 20%. Lower concentrations may not be effective, while higher concentrations may cause irritation of the skin.
- Prioritize the product combines Vitamin C with Vitamin E or ferulic acid. This combination not only helps stabilize the Vitamin C, but also enhance the effect of anti-oxidant, protects the skin from oxidative stress and sun.
- Check the ingredient list and packaging products to ensure quality. Select products from reputed brands and are carefully packed in bottles of dark to avoid oxidation.
Manual
- Time of use: Apply after cleansing step and previous step moisturizer in the skin care process. Vitamin C Serum should be used in the morning to protect your skin from the harmful effects of the environment or in the evening to support the recovery process of the skin.
- Frequency: Use 1-2 times per day. If your skin is sensitivelet's start with the frequency of lower and gradually increase when the skin is already familiar with the product.
- Dosage: Take a small amount just enough to apply evenly onto face, avoiding contact with the eyes and mouth.
How to preserve
- Vitamin C is a component susceptible to oxidation when exposed to light and air, resulting in lost efficiency. So, choose products that are packaged in bottles of dark color, design air tightness as droppers.
- Store product in a dry, cool, avoid direct sunlight. If possible, store the product in the refrigerator to extend the period of use.
- Check out the color and scent of the product periodically. If the product turns brown or dark orange, it is a sign that the product has been oxidized and needs to be replaced.
